Join us for The Mending Circle: Creating for a Cause

At Advocates for Recovery Colorado, we believe that connection is a vital piece of the recovery journey. To foster that connection, we are launching The Mending Circle, a recurring gathering for crafters of all skill levels.

This isn't just a hobby group-it's a mission. Our goal is to spend the year creating handmade hats, scarves and blankets. In the upcoming winter, we will host an outreach event to distribute these items to individuals in our community experiencing homelessness, providing much-needed warmth during the Colorado winter.

No supplies? No problem. We will have some materials to get you started.

Come for the venting stay for the mending. Let's knit our community closer together!

Our first meeting will be on Saturday January 24th, 2026 from 12:30 to 2:30 PM. The meetings will continue every Saturday after at the same time.

PSP ECHO (Peer Support Professionals Empowering Community Helping Others) is a safe, supportive meeting space exclusively for Peer Support Professionals—no participants, supervisors, or administrators.

This is your space to connect with fellow peer workers from all backgrounds (recovery, mental health, unhoused, veteran, and more) for support, networking, resources, and collaboration. It’s a brave place to vent, ask questions, and uplift one another.

We all need time away from those we support to recharge and care for ourselves. Join us and be part of a strong, empowered community!
